Use conditional logic to show or hide invoice line items or terms based on service types, discounts, or tax jurisdictions to reduce confusion on final PDF invoices.
Generate and send multiple personalized PDF invoices in a single operation to support subscription billing or batch invoicing workflows efficiently.
Programmatic PDF generation and upload enable integration with billing systems, automating invoice creation, signing requests, and archiving without manual steps.
Support for settings that align signatures and storage with HIPAA, FERPA, or industry requirements when handling sensitive invoice data.
Store OCR-enabled PDFs and metadata to make invoice retrieval fast for finance teams and auditors.
A centralized template repository stores approved invoice formats, enforces branding and field positions, and speeds document creation for teams producing recurring or one-off invoices.
Auto-fill capabilities and data mapping pull customer, line-item, and tax data from CRM or spreadsheets to reduce manual entry and ensure consistent values across exported PDF invoices.
Embedded signature fields, signer order, and reminder settings enable secure electronic signing of PDF invoices while preserving the original exported document for audit purposes.
Automated PDF export, cloud storage routing, and retention tagging ensure invoices are archived in central repositories with consistent naming and access controls for future audits.

Google invoice template PDF workflows are compatible with modern desktop browsers, mobile devices, and many cloud storage platforms used for signing and archiving.
Confirm specific browser versions and mobile OS compatibility for your chosen eSignature provider and test PDF rendering across devices to ensure field placement and signature flows behave consistently for senders and recipients.
A consultant prepares a monthly invoice in Google Docs and exports to PDF to lock layout before sending to clients.
Resulting in faster approvals and predictable cash collection for contracted work.
A small SaaS vendor generates billing statements from Google Sheets, converts them to PDF, and attaches them to automated emails.
Leading to clearer transaction records and easier month-end reconciliation for accounting teams.
